HNA founder dies

THE chairman and co-founder of Chinese aviation and hospitality giant HNA Group has died in France at the age of 57, after falling off a wall while taking photographs in Provence.

Wang Jian had climbed onto a parapet for a snap in the village of Bonnieux when he lost his balance and fell backward onto rocks about 15m below, according to local police, who said rescue services could not revive him.

HNA Group employs more than 400,000 people worldwide, and has stakes in multiple global airlines including Virgin Australia as well as Chinese carriers Hong Kong Airlines, Beijing Capital, Hainan Airlines & Fuzhou Airlines.

Hospitality interests include the Radisson Hotel Group, while it recently sold a stake in Hilton.

Wang owned 15% of HNA, with a statement saying the board was “committed to the orderly continuity of the company’s business”.
